Combat Flight Planning Software (CFPS)

Definition

Combat Flight Planning Software (CFPS) is a specialized tool used within the defense sector to assist in the strategic planning and execution of military flight operations. This software is integral for mission planning, providing comprehensive capabilities for creating and analyzing flight routes, weapon delivery schedules, and airdrop procedures. CFPS ensures precise navigation and operational effectiveness by utilizing advanced geospatial data and integrates seamlessly with various defense systems to enhance situational awareness and tactical advantage.

What is Combat Flight Planning Software (CFPS)?

Combat Flight Planning Software is designed to support military operations by providing detailed visualization and analysis of potential flight routes. It incorporates geographic information system (GIS) technology to create interactive maps that display terrain, weather conditions, and potential threats. CFPS is utilized primarily by military planners and pilots to conduct mission rehearsals and optimize route effectiveness. It aids in planning for precision weapon delivery by simulating various scenarios and trajectories, thus enhancing the likelihood of mission success and minimizing collateral damage. Furthermore, CFPS plays a crucial role in airdrop planning, allowing for the accurate computation of drop zones and ensuring that supplies or personnel are deployed efficiently and safely.

In Falcon View, a component of CFPS, users can preview combat routes directly on a digital map interface. This feature allows for the visualization of planned routes, providing a clear picture of the operational landscape, navigational challenges, and possible alternative paths. By enabling the preview of weapon delivery strategies, CFPS aids in assessing the impact of different delivery methods and adjusting plans accordingly. Similarly, airdrop planning within CFPS ensures that planners can designate optimal drop points with precision, taking into account factors such as aircraft capabilities, environmental constraints, and tactical necessities.
